Keyword Research: Finding the Right Search Terms

Effective keyword research is essential for boosting Pinterest visibility and engagement. This process requires identifying the exact terms and phrases that potential users are searching for on the platform. By utilizing tools such as Pinterest's search bar, users can discover trending keywords and related searches, which provide insights into audience interests.

Reviewing competing accounts and high-performing pins also generates valuable data, uncovering which keywords create traffic. It is essential to focus on long-tail keywords, as these usually have lower competition and cater to niche markets, elevating the possibility of engagement.

Additionally, integrating timely and popular keywords can further enhance visibility, matching content with existing interests. By emphasizing relevant keywords and incorporating them naturally into pin descriptions, titles, and boards, users can considerably increase their chances of reaching a more extensive audience. Overall, well-executed keyword research lays the groundwork for a thriving Pinterest strategy.

Approaches to Keyword Optimization

An optimized pin description can significantly improve visibility on Pinterest, bringing in more users and increasing engagement. Successful keyword optimization involves identifying pertinent terms that resonate with the target audience. Leveraging tools like Pinterest Trends and Google Keyword Planner can aid in discovering trending keywords connected to specific niches. It is essential to integrate these keywords naturally within the pin description, guaranteeing they fit seamlessly into the content. Moreover, using long-tail keywords can help target more specific searches, increasing the likelihood of reaching interested users. By strategically placing keywords in the first few lines of the description, creators can increase their chances of appearing in search results, ultimately driving higher traffic and fostering greater interaction with their pins.

Using Rich Pins for Enhanced Engagement

Integrating Rich Pins into a Pinterest marketing plan can significantly enhance user engagement and interaction. Rich Pins offer additional information directly on the pin itself, elevating the user experience and encouraging more clicks. There are three types of Rich Pins: Product, Article, and Recipe, each customized to deliver relevant data. For instance, Product Pins show real-time pricing and availability, making them particularly effective for e-commerce brands. Article Pins enable detailed descriptions and authorship, working to increase traffic to blog posts. Recipe Pins offer cooking times, ingredients, and serving sizes, attracting food enthusiasts. By leveraging these features, businesses can create a more interactive and informative experience, driving higher engagement rates. Rich Pins not only make content more discoverable but also create credibility and trustworthiness. In summary, leveraging Rich Pins can significantly strengthen a brand's presence on Pinterest, driving more traffic and fostering a loyal audience.
